Golf Tips to Cure your Slice and Improve your Ball Striking

The two most common problems golfers seem to struggle with are a) slicing the ball and b) inconsistent ball striking. Perhaps you blister it right off the sweet spot one time, and the next you hit it fat (behind the ball) or thin (on top of the ball) even though you are absolutely sure your set up, grip and swing were virtually identical between those same two shots. Or maybe you find yourself aiming way to the left (if you are right handed) hoping that by the time your ball finishes its impressive banana-shaped flight it will end up somewhere near the fairway. Then, low and behold, you line up like that only to hit it straight into the trees. After struggling with the same two problems for many years I have found what I believe is the root cause of both problems, and would like to share with you what has helped my golf game immensely and hopefully can help yours also.

We all know that the key to a consistent golf shot is returning the club head to a square position at the point of impact. If your club face is open at impact, the ball will slice. If it is closed at impact, you will hook your shot. Also, if you do not return the club head so it contacts your ball cleanly on the ground you will either be hitting fat or thin, neither of which you want to do. Although a lot of things can contribute to those problems the one thing that I have noticed in my own game and in observing others who have these two problems is this: too much lower body movement during the golf swing. Very simply put if anything below your waistline is “loosey-goosey” when you are swinging the golf club the likelihood of making good shots consistently is almost nil.

Watch the professionals on television some weekend and concentrate on their knees while they swing, especially when they are hitting a driver off the tee. You will immediately see that no matter how hard they swing, their lower body is very, very still during their entire swing motion. In some cases the distance between the inside of their two knees does not even change until after the club impacts the ball. Try to catch the ladies tour on television and watch their knees. Since many of them wear skirts when they play the lack of lateral movement in their knees is readily apparent.

]]>

When you sway back and then forward, or if your hips move laterally more than an inch or two at most when you shift your weight you are probably too “noisy” with your lower body when you swing. Fixing this problem does not require a lot of strength or special skills, but it does require getting used to what will at first feel like an unnatural swing, but one that will be your best friend once you get accustomed to it and your muscle memory is trained to do it automatically.

One practice drill that you can do in your back yard to learn to shift your weight, instead of sway it, that does not even require hitting balls is to get a couple of quarter-inch diameter wood rods that are long enough to be waist high after you push them into the ground (3 to 3 1/2 feet long). You can buy them for very little at your favorite hardware store. Push one into the ground about an inch to the right of the back part of your right foot when you take a stance like you are addressing the ball, and one about an inch to the left of the back part of your left foot. If you have set it up correctly you are now pretending to address a golf ball with your normal stance, and you have two wood rods pushed into the ground in such a way that the top of each rod is about even with your waist and they are positioned just outside the heel of both your shoes respectively. Then take some practice swings. You should be able to make a complete swing without touching the rods with either of your hips or with the outside of your knees. This drill will also help you learn to make a full turn in your follow through while maintaining good balance. Do not stiffen up so much that you do not follow through. Just concentrate on shifting your weight to the inside of your back foot on your backswing, then shifting it to the inside of your front foot on your forward swing, while making a full turn at your waist without moving laterally during any part of the swing.

After a while you will be shifting your weight back correctly on your backswing but you will not be swaying your body when you do so. Likewise you will be shifting your weight forward correctly on your downswing but you will not be swaying in that direction. Just remember: shifting does not mean swaying! Now the concept of “coiling” your weight back and shifting it forward will make sense. Many golf tips will refer to coiling against the inside of your back leg on your take away, but for years I had no idea what that meant so I was swaying. Now, I shift, and my game has improved considerably.

Once you get used to how this new swing feels head to the practice range and hit a bucket of balls with your favorite iron without regard for distance. Any iron will do but a five or six iron would be a good choice if you are not sure where to begin. Just get used to your new swing while you hit real shots. At first, slow down both your backswing and forward swing. You are not trying to set any distance records. You just need to get the feel of your new swing. As you begin to get used to your new swing, start swinging at your normal pace, but do not swing any harder than you did before applying these techniques. If the driving range allows you to hit off real grass go ahead and push your wood rods in the ground and hit some shots that way.

Keeping your lower body “quiet” applies to all the shots you take whether it is a driver off the tee or a wedge from 15 feet off the green. By limiting your lower body movement and learning to shift, not sway, you will consistently return your club head squarely to the ball, thereby eliminating slicing and inconsistent ball striking.

Golf Ball Spin Rates – Spin Your Way To Victory!

The kind of spin that is generated by the golfer is best known by the way the ball behaves after hitting the ground. The ball can either, ‘spin and stop’, ‘spin and roll back’ or just ‘spin and roll on.’ Such movement is dependent on the way the ball was hit, the make of the ball and the club used to hit the ball. Some balls may spin more than the others, in air as well as after impact with the ground. The spin rate of a golf ball also determines the extent to which the ball stays hit in the air.

Any way that you hit the ball, there is certain degree of spin that always comes into play. If you hit the ball lower towards the ground, more backspin is generated. On the other hand if you hit the ball higher, a kind of topspin is generated that thrusts the ball further. Thus, the spin rate of the golf ball varies depending on which part of the ball gets hit and with what impact.

If there is low spin rate on the ball, it will drop much quickly on the ground and won’t get a very high elevation. However, if the spin rate is on the higher side, the ball will almost bear the appearance of a balloon and travel higher towards the sky. Getting the perfect spin rate is a challenging task for every golfer, beginners and experts alike. Following are some tips that may come to your rescue while trying to generate that perfect spin on your golf ball:

]]>

- You must stand with your feet much closer to each other as compared to while taking a normal shot.
- You must position your body in such a way that the golf ball is nearer to your back foot.
- Make use of a flop wedge (60 degrees)
- If you don’t have a flop wedge, a sand wedge can also be used.
- Take your swing from an upright surface.
- You must make sure that you hit the golf ball right underneath it, before digging out the divot.
- Feel free and play your normal shot.

The spin rate of the golf ball also depends on how it has been made. Many pros suggest that one should employ three layered (three-piece) golf balls rather than two layered (two-piece) ones to obtain maximum spin and thus better control over the shot.

The way the golf ball is constructed is dominantly responsible for the rate of spin on it. The two-piece balls though more popular with common golfers don’t offer as much rate of spin as is generated with the three-piece balls. This holds true for both the wounded and solid core three-piece balls.

If you are looking to derive maximum length from your hit, you must keep in mind to generate as less spin as you can. There is always a moderate way of going about your hits so that you get the distance as well as the control required to make the ball halt at will. The best form of golf ball spin rate is one that enables you to hit the ball as far as you want and also make it stop just at the right time. It is difficult but not impossible. Golf Tips for Driving your Golf ball longer

Article by Keith Barker









We all want to know the golf tips for driving your golf ball longer. Every golfer I know wants more distance off the tee and is willing to try almost anything to make it happen. I’m sure that I have written about this in some of my other articles, but let me just go over again some of my techniques. These are some of the techniques that a lot of the pro’s use and in time, if you play long enough, you’ll figure out these little secrets for yourself eventually.
The very first thing that I want to throw at you is some golf grip tips. When your swinging hard, you want to be able to return the clubface squarely to the ball, so you need to maintain very light grip pressure. If you grip too tightly, you will tense up from your hands to your shoulders and maybe even down your back. Then, you’ll end up rushing your downswing and get the handle too far ahead of the clubhead, probably causing a pushed shot or hitting the ball, who knows where. So remember, light grip pressure is important when using your driver, woods, and your high irons, like the 3,4,5. Choke down a little and grip a little harder when your hitting out of the rough or approach shots to the green. These are great golf lessons that I,m giving you so go to the range and see for yourself.

Next, and this creates speed and speed equals distance, try adjusting your stance a little by turning your front foot out to where it’s about 30 degrees open. This will help you to clear your left side faster on your downswing, right side if your a lefty, creating faster arm speed. You will need to go to the driving range and work this out and figure out exactly where your front foot needs to be in order for this to work for you. Just hit a few balls adjusting your foot in out and further out, until you find what works best for you. This adjustment will help to add distance.

The next major golf tip would be to take your club back and make as wide an arc as possible on your backswing, all the way to the top. This will create more centrifugal force and clubhead speed through the ball. Don’t misunderstand me here, swing within yourself and maintain your center of gravity. Keep your spine angle upright and head fairly straight and swing your arms and torso around, keeping your eye on the ball at all times. I want you to make a complete shoulder turn as possible and make a slower and longer swing. Did you catch that? A Slower, Longer swing. Slowing down your golf swing will fix so many problems for beginners, I just can’t begin to tell you. I know what your thinking; “But, I have to swing harder so that I can hit it farther.” Not true my friend. If you get up there and try to kill it or, even worse, try to keep up with what everybody else is doing, your not going to have a good round. Never try to play someone else’s game, play to your strength’s and work hard in the areas where your having the most trouble. Learn to course manage your game. If it’s a dog leg hole, hit your ball to where you clear the dog leg and land your ball so that it’s sitting where it needs to be for the next shot. Don’t automatically pull out your driver and try to force it. Make calculated shots and be dilligent in practicing your short game. In finishing your backswing, lead with your lower body, then bring your arms around and through the ball.
